Palisade Rim (upper) is a highly rated 4 mile popular black diamond singletrack trail located near Palisade Colorado. This mountain bike primary trail can be used both directions. On average it takes 45 minutes to complete this trail.

      Best ridden counterclockwise. Climb along the cliff edge while enjoying the view and enjoy a fast descent on your return.
